Al Harid
Al Harid is a hamlet in Rumada, Urdan Sub-district, Ibb Governorate and has about 144 residents and an elevation of 1,526 metres. Al Harid is situated nearby to the hamlet Al Zabr, as well as near Al-Ma’than.- Type: Hamlet with 144 residents
- Description: human settlement in Yemen
- Also known as: “Al Ḩarīd”

Al-Maabar
Locality
Al-Maabar is one of the villages of Uzlah Urdan, in Al Udayn District, which belongs to Ibb Governorate in Yemen. Its population was 2,388 according to the 2004 Yemen Census.
